在Vue中绑定"v-html"上的click事件可以通过以下步骤实现: 1. 首先,在Vue组件中,使用v-html指令将HTML内容动态渲染到模板中。例如,可以将一个包含点击事件的HTML字符串赋...
vue用v-html命令解析带有html标签的内容,a标签内有点击事件(格式:<a @click='test()'>我是a标签</a>),但是采用v-html解析标签时会导致点击事件失效 就是前面提到的v-html的特性:将添加进去的@click事件按string形式插入,没有作为 Vue 模板进行编译。 解决方法: vue代码如下: 1 2 3 <div @click="eventT...
vue在v-html中绑定的点击事件失效处理方法 实际开发中遇见v-html中绑定的点击事件无效 主要代码如下: vue中代码 /*@autor:dantaxiaozi @time:2021/4/28 @desc: 解决v-html中点击事件无效的方法*/<template><divid="announcementList"><divclass="affiche_text"><pv-html="textContent"@click="triggerClick">...
vue用v-html命令解析带有html标签的内容,a标签内有点击事件(格式:<a @click='test()'>我是a标签</a>),但是采用v-html解析标签时会导致点击事件失效 就是前面提到的v-html的特性:将添加进去的@click事件按string形式插入,没有作为 Vue 模板进行编译。 解决方法: vue代码如下: <div @click="eventTemp"><sp...
如何在Vue中的“ v-html”上绑定点击事件 <template> <div > <div style="font-size: 12px;" @click.native="onZyInfo(item)" v-html="formatEscapeChar(item.attachmentContent)"></div> </div> </template> methods:{ onZyInfo(item){ } }...
例如html内容是<span id='99' class='my-class'>XXXXX</span> 添加class: 在.vue文件中新建一个<style></style>标签,将my-class的内容写在里面,注意不能带scoped .my-class{XXXXX} 添加click点击事件: 在v-html所在标签外的标签进行绑定,通过event来判定点击到哪个标签,也就是说事件不要绑定在v-html所在...
dblclick), 执行双击事件(dblclick)时却会触发两次单击事件(click)。 先看一下点击事件的执行顺序:
你想问 v-html 渲染出来的 HTML 怎么绑定事件? 直接绑定的话有很多限制,一般都是在容器组件上绑定,然后利用事件代理机制。 伪代码: <div v-html="html" @click="handleClick"> <!-- 给它绑定事件 --> </div> handleClick(e) { if (e.target.nodeName === 'A') { // e.target 就是被点击的...
比如我有一个按钮的字符串 {代码...} 然后我用v-html渲染到vue页面上,请问怎么给这个button绑定点击事件?
1、要嵌入到vue代码中的部分html代码 双击图片会调用imgDbClick方法,此方法为html里面的方法。<img ...